Formula
slug/imp gal = oz/ft3 × 0.000312
oz/ft3 = slug/imp gal × 3206.509672
Conversion table
| 1 oz/ft3 | 0.000312 slug/imp gal |
| 5 oz/ft3 | 0.001559 slug/imp gal |
| 10 oz/ft3 | 0.003119 slug/imp gal |
| 20 oz/ft3 | 0.006237 slug/imp gal |
| 50 oz/ft3 | 0.015593 slug/imp gal |
| 100 oz/ft3 | 0.031187 slug/imp gal |
| 500 oz/ft3 | 0.155933 slug/imp gal |
| 1000 oz/ft3 | 0.311866 slug/imp gal |

How the formula works
Both ounce per cubic foot and slug per imperial gallon meas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in ounce per cubic foot by 0.000312 to get slug per imperial gallon. To reverse the conversion, multiply a slug per imperial gallon value by 3206.509672 to get back to ounce per cubic foot.
